Probiotics for Diverticulosis: A Review

Diverticulosis is a common gastrointestinal condition that affects the large intestine. It occurs when small, bulging pouches called diverticula form in the walls of the colon. These pouches can become inflamed or infected, leading to a condition known as diverticulitis. While the exact cause of diverticulosis is not fully understood, it is believed to be linked to a combination of factors, including age, a low-fiber diet, and the weakening of the colon wall.

Understanding Diverticulosis

To understand how probiotics can potentially benefit individuals with diverticulosis, it is important to first gain a clear understanding of this condition. Diverticulosis often develops over time and is more common in older adults. The inner lining of the colon pushes through weak spots in the outer layer, forming small pouches or diverticula. These pouches are typically harmless and may not cause any symptoms. However, in some cases, they can become inflamed or infected, leading to symptoms such as abdominal pain, bloating, constipation, or diarrhea.

Symptoms and Diagnosis of Diverticulosis

Diverticulosis is often diagnosed during routine screenings or when symptoms develop. The symptoms vary from person to person and can range from mild to severe. Common symptoms include abdominal pain or discomfort, bloating, changes in bowel habits, and rectal bleeding.

When a healthcare professional suspects diverticulosis, they may perform a physical examination to check for tenderness in the abdomen. They will also review the individual's medical history, looking for any risk factors or previous episodes of diverticulitis. In order to make an accurate diagnosis, diagnostic tests such as a colonoscopy or abdominal imaging may be ordered.

A colonoscopy is a procedure that allows a healthcare professional to examine the inside of the colon using a long, flexible tube with a camera on the end. This procedure can help identify the presence of diverticula and any signs of inflammation or infection. Abdominal imaging, such as a CT scan or ultrasound, may also be used to visualize the colon and confirm the diagnosis.

It is important to note that diverticulosis can often be asymptomatic, meaning that individuals may not experience any symptoms even if they have diverticula. However, it is still important to monitor the condition and take steps to prevent complications, such as diverticulitis.

The Science Behind Probiotics

Probiotics are live microorganisms that provide numerous health benefits when consumed in adequate amounts. They are often referred to as "good bacteria" as they help maintain a healthy balance of microorganisms in the gut. Probiotics can be found in certain foods, such as yogurt, or taken as a dietary supplement.

But what exactly are probiotics? Probiotics are comprised of different strains of bacteria or yeast, each with their own specific benefits. The most common types of bacteria found in probiotics include Lactobacillus and Bifidobacterium. These bacteria have been extensively studied for their ability to support digestive health and boost the immune system.

Furthermore, probiotics play a role in enhancing the function of the intestinal barrier. The intestinal barrier acts as a protective shield, preventing the entry of harmful substances, such as toxins and pathogens, into the bloodstream. When the intestinal barrier is compromised, it can lead to various health issues, including inflammation and autoimmune disorders.

Studies have shown that probiotics can strengthen the intestinal barrier by promoting the production of tight junction proteins. These proteins act like glue, holding the cells of the intestinal lining together and preventing the leakage of harmful substances. By maintaining the integrity of the intestinal barrier, probiotics help safeguard our overall health and well-being.

Choosing the Right Probiotics

When considering probiotics for diverticulosis, it is important to choose the right strains and products. The effectiveness of probiotics can vary depending on the specific strains used and the quality of the product. Here are a few factors to consider:

Factors to Consider

  1. Strain: Look for specific strains, such as Lactobacillus and Bifidobacterium, that have been shown to have potential benefits for individuals with gastrointestinal conditions.
  2. CFU Count: CFU stands for colony-forming units, which indicate the number of viable bacteria present in a probiotic supplement. Higher CFU counts are generally considered more effective.
  3. Product Quality: Choose reputable brands that prioritize quality control measures to ensure the viability of the probiotics throughout the manufacturing process.
  4. Additional Ingredients: Consider whether the probiotic supplement contains any additional ingredients that may be beneficial or potentially problematic for your specific health needs.

Probiotic Strains and Diverticulosis

While research is ongoing, certain strains of probiotics have shown promise for individuals with diverticulosis. Lactobacillus rhamnosus GG and Bifidobacterium lactis BB-12 are two strains that have been specifically studied for their potential benefits in supporting gut health and reducing inflammation.
